Reviews"This is a very useful book describing many aspects and applications of nonlinear sigma-models. [...] One of the useful features of the book is that several chapters and sections can essentially be read independently, making this a practical reference book. However, the introductory chapters should also make it accessible to anyone with a basic knowledge of quantum field theory and supersymmetry." (Mathematical Reviews 2002b)

Table Of Content1 Introduction.- 2 Classical Structure and Renormalization.- 3 Supersymmetric NLSM.- 4 NLSM and Extended Superspace.- 5 NLSM and 2d Conformai Field Theory.- 6 NLSM and Strings.- 7 Chiral (1,0) NLSM and Heterotic Strings.- 8 LEEA in 4d, N = 2 Gauge Field Theories.- 9 Generalizations of NLSM.- References.- Text Abbreviations.
SynopsisThe idea for this book came to me after visiting DESY and CERN in 1996 and 1997. For a long time, two-dimensional Non-Linear Sigma-Models (NLSM) served as a useful laboratory for the study of perturbative and n- perturbative properties of four-dimensional non-Abelian gauge theories, since they share many remarkable features like renormalizability, asymptotic fr- dom, solitons, confinement, etc. [1]. For instance, the low-energy effective physics of pions in four-dimensional Quantum Chromo dynamics (QCD) - ceives the most natural description in terms of the principal NLSM whose solitonic solutions (skyrmions) can be interpreted as baryons [2]. In fact, NLSM are also important for spontaneous symmetry breaking, extended - per symmetry and supergravity, conformal field theory, gravity and string t- ory. This book is entirely devoted to recent applications of NLSM in various dimensions. In the late 1980s and while in Russia, I wrote the book [3] entitled 'N- linear Sigma-Models in Quantum Field Theory and Strings', which was ev- tually published in Russian by the Nauka Publishers in 1992. This book is not a translation of my earlier book into English, though it shares about one third of its content with the Russian edition. The main additions include the two-dimensional Wess-Zumino-Novikov-Witten (WZNW) models in c- formal field theory and strings, gauging NLSM isometries, four-dimensional NLSM with N = 2 extended supersymmetry in the context of Seiberg-Witten theory and M-theory, N = 2 strings and D-brane dynamics. This book is not a collection of all known facts about NLSM., This is the first comprehensive presentation of the quantum non-linear sigma-models. The original papers consider in detail geometrical properties and renormalization of a generic non-linear sigma-model, illustrated by explicit multi-loop calculations in perturbation theory.
